Инструменты пользователя

Инструменты сайта


примеры_конфигураций

Различия

Показаны различия между двумя версиями страницы.

Ссылка на это сравнение

Предыдущая версия справа и слева Предыдущая версия
Следующая версия
Предыдущая версия
Следующая версия Следующая версия справа и слева
примеры_конфигураций [2019/06/15 20:28]
admin
примеры_конфигураций [2019/06/17 00:00]
admin [Пример 2: Сенсор CO2 CCS811 и влажности HD1080 на ESP8266]
Строка 4: Строка 4:
 Далее, надо просто подключить контроллер к роутеру, имеющему выход в Интернет. После перезапуска, контроллер загрузит настройки из Личного Кабинета. После того, как вы убедитесь, что все работает, можно будет сохранить настройки в постоянную память контроллера (команда save в CLI) и сделать его независимым от наличия доступа в интернет. Далее, надо просто подключить контроллер к роутеру, имеющему выход в Интернет. После перезапуска, контроллер загрузит настройки из Личного Кабинета. После того, как вы убедитесь, что все работает, можно будет сохранить настройки в постоянную память контроллера (команда save в CLI) и сделать его независимым от наличия доступа в интернет.
  
-Для тех, кто не доверяет - можно разместить настройки на своем собственном http сервере, в корне. Хотя это не так удобно. Формат имени файла: http://MY_CONFIG_SERVER/cnf/12-12-12-12-12-12.config.json+Для тех, кто не доверяет  - можно разместить настройки на своем собственном http сервере, в папке cnf. Хотя это не так удобно. Формат имени файла: http://MY_CONFIG_SERVER/cnf/12-12-12-12-12-12.config.json (вместо 12-12-12-12-12-12 ваш mac адрес)
 После этого выполнить через CLI команду <code>get <MY_CONFIG_SERVER></code> После этого выполнить через CLI команду <code>get <MY_CONFIG_SERVER></code>
 Контроллер запомнит ваш сервер и далее, будет загружать обновление конфига из этого источника. (на ESP32, STM, NRF пока не сохраняется, но сделаем) Контроллер запомнит ваш сервер и далее, будет загружать обновление конфига из этого источника. (на ESP32, STM, NRF пока не сохраняется, но сделаем)
Строка 36: Строка 36:
 </code> </code>
  
-===== Пример 2: Сенсор CO2 CCS811 и влажности HD1080 на ESP82 =====+===== Пример 2: Сенсор CO2 CCS811 и влажности HD1080 на ESP8266 ===== 
 +Дополнительно, считываем значение аналогового входа А0, преобразовываем к шкале 0-100 и подавляем шумы
 <code>   <code>  
   {   {
 "in":{ "in":{
           "1":{"T":5,"emit":"myhome/s_out/1"},           "1":{"T":5,"emit":"myhome/s_out/1"},
-          "2":{"T":6,"emit":"myhome/s_out/2"}+          "2":{"T":6,"emit":"myhome/s_out/2"}, 
 +          "17":{"T":64,"emit":"analog","map":[0,1024,0,100,5]}
          },          },
   "mqtt":["LHexample02","test.mosquitto.org"]   "mqtt":["LHexample02","test.mosquitto.org"]
примеры_конфигураций.txt · Последнее изменение: 2021/09/25 04:16 — 176.31.125.95